R-3
Residential-Single-family District
The R-3 district is primarily intended to accommodate detached houses in areas served by central water service and paved roads and where police, fire and emergency medical services are readily available. As with all residential districts, the R-3 district also allows some other uses typically found within residential areas in Will County.; Conservation design subdivisions are allowed and encouraged for new residential developments in the R-3 district.
